Biography of the Artist.
Yokana Augustine born in 1997 Kampala Uganda and raised in Seeta, Mukono District. I completed my bachelor’s degree in industrial and fine art (BIFA) at Makerere University in 2017. In 2018, I was invited to teach at my secondary school (Our Lady of Africa SS, Namilyango) as a teacher of fine art until 2019. I concentrated more on painting art pieces during Covid time where I attained more experience. I normally get concepts or art ideas from daily magazines, daily activities and visiting game parks. Some of my recent works tackle social issues such as racism, human rights as a voice for voiceless and an assertion of my relevance as an artist to modern civilization and human dignity. I use art materials like acrylics and oil on canvas. My style renders a lot of details, and my strength lies in controlling light, perspective and tone variations.
Currently I venture in agriculture as a maize farmer in the countryside of Kayunga and still venture in the art by painting a few art pieces.
As far as the market is concerned, I have worked hand in hand with Kamb Johnson (artist at national theatre) with to create more art exposure by empowering multiple upcoming artists in various parts of Uganda.
